Early type vaccum/ps pump leak???
I have an early 1991 power steering pump and it has been leaking ever since I got the truck. The previous owner had replaced the gasket between the gear housing and pump three times(2 under waranty), I started there. It still leaks. I think that it is leaking at one of the other gasket surfaces, but am having trouble identifing the location. Does anyone have any experience fixing these assemblies? Can I pickup parts anywhere? I know that there is a common fix for the later pumps involving an odd size seal and o-ring, but CRFF said that my pump was an earlier version. Can anyone help? It is the only leak on this truck!
